Pucara de Quitor is a remnant of an ancient Indian fortress (Pucara means fortress in the Quechua Indian language) just two and a half kilometers north of San Pedro de Atacama. To this day, only the remains of the terraces have been preserved here. From the highest point, however, there is a wonderful view not only of the picturesque valley of the San Pedro River, but also of the monumental volcano Licancabur on the horizon.
